Question
Classification of fluoroquinolones .Describe the mechanism of action, therapeutic uses and
adverse effects of sparfloxacin. (2 + 2+ 2 =6)
Q16 marksEssays
Answer
Classification of fluoroquinolones
- First generation: Nalidixic acid
- Second generation: Ciprofloxacin, Norfloxacin, Ofloxacin
- Third generation: Levofloxacin, Sparfloxacin
- Fourth generation: Moxifloxacin, Gatifloxacin (added anaerobic cover)
Mechanism of action of sparfloxacin
- Inhibits bacterial DNA gyrase (topoisomerase II) and topoisomerase IV
- Prevents DNA supercoiling and replication → bactericidal
Therapeutic uses
- Respiratory tract infections (community-acquired pneumonia — enhanced Gram-positive/pneumococcal activity compared to earlier fluoroquinolones)
- Tuberculosis (as part of MDR-TB regimens)
- Sexually transmitted infections
Adverse effects
- Photosensitivity (more pronounced with sparfloxacin than other fluoroquinolones)
- QT prolongation/cardiotoxicity
- GI upset
- Tendinitis/tendon rupture
- CNS effects (headache, dizziness)
- Arthropathy in growing cartilage — avoided in children/pregnancy
